Where temperatures below about 95 °C (200 °F) are sufficient, as for space heating, flat-plate collectors of the nonconcentrating type are generally used. Because of the relatively high heat losses through the glazing, flat plate collectors will not reach temperatures much above 200 °C (400 °F) even when the heat transfer fluid is stagnant. When the sun shines onto a solar panel, energy from the sunlight is absorbed by the PV cells in the panel. This energy creates electrical charges that move in response to an internal electrical field in the cell, causing electricity to flow. . Solar panels convert sunlight into electricity through photovoltaic (PV) cells made from semiconductor materials like silicon. When sunlight hits the surface, it excites electrons, generating direct current (DC), which is then converted into usable alternating current (AC) by an inverter.
